FormFactor sues MJC for patent infringement

News
FormFactor, Inc. announced the filing of a patent infringement lawsuit against Micronics Japan Co., Ltd., MJC, a Japanese corporation.

The lawsuit, filed in federal district court in California, charges MJC is infringing four US patents that cover key aspects of FormFactor's wafer probe cards.

Igor Khandros, FormFactor CEO, stated, "We can not condone unauthorized third parties using our proprietary technology and this latest infringement action is a necessary step to protect our investment in research and development."

The filing of the US complaint against MJC and its subsidiary follows actions initiated by FormFactor in 2004 against Phicom in the Seoul Southern District Court in Korea, and in US federal court in Oregon in 2005. All the cases are still pending and are a part of the Company's global IP strategy.
